""The Fulfilling Of The Times Of The Gentiles: A Conspicuous Sign Of The End"" is a book written by William Cuninghame in 1847. The book discusses the fulfillment of biblical prophecies regarding the end times and the role of the Gentiles in this process. Cuninghame argues that the current state of the world, particularly the rise of European powers and the spread of Christianity, indicates that the end times are near. He also discusses the significance of the restoration of Israel and the return of the Jews to their homeland. The book is written from a Christian perspective and draws heavily on biblical texts to support its arguments.
